  • Patent number: 10053640
    Abstract: A method and kit for treatment of a stainless steel or other nickel alloy component utilized in a crude oil service operation including cleaning a surface of the component to remove surface contamination; drying the cleaned surface of the component; applying a coat of Self-Assembled Monolayer of Phosphonate (SAMP) to the cleaned and dried surface of the component to form a treated component; and installing the treated component into a section of a crude oil service operation. The coating reduces paraffin/asphaltene deposition on the component. The kit includes a cleaner wipe impregnated with a cleaning substance for cleaning the component; a nano-coating wipe impregnated with a SAMP for applying a nano-coating of the SAMP to the component; and instructions for treating said component utilizing the cleaner wipe and the nano-coating wipe.

  • Patent number: 7584656
    Abstract: A rain gauge device is provided that uses a plurality of conductivity sensors to determine liquid levels. Certain rain gauge devices include a plurality of conductivity sensors fixed along the length of a support member, wherein each conductivity sensor comprises at least two selectable electrodes for sensing the presence of a liquid by measuring a conductivity of the liquid between these electrodes when a liquid is present between the sensing electrodes, and an electronic command unit adapted to apply a voltage between a common electrode and a selected electrode. Level measuring devices are also provided that comprise a collector, a measuring tube, a plurality of conductivity sensors and an electronic command unit for applying a voltage across the conductivity sensors and for converting the conductivity measured into a digital output for each increment. Methods of use and operation are also provided.

  • Patent number: 5347864
    Abstract: An improved liquid level measuring apparatus having a plurality of spaced reed switches having a microprocessor attached to the liquid level measuring sensor apparatus. The switches are wired together in parallel and in sets and are addressed by a shift register for providing a parallel to serial shift of the switch status position to the microprocessor. This allows a reduction in the number of conductors existing the sensor and providing an output signal indicating the vertical position of a float relative to the switches. A microprocessor control notes any inoperative switches, disregards the reading of the inoperative switches in calculating liquid level, and provides stored information to the measurement process for compensating for defective switches.
